The primary macromolecules that serve as structural components of a cell are proteins, lipids, and carbohydrates. Proteins, such as cytoskeletal elements, provide support and shape. Lipids, particularly phospholipids, form the cell membrane, creating a barrier that maintains the cell's integrity. Carbohydrates, often found on the cell surface, play roles in cell recognition and communication, contributing to the overall structure and function of the cell.
Some of the lipids found in a cell membrane include phospholipids (such as phosphatidylcholine and phosphatidylethanolamine), glycolipids, and cholesterol. These lipids play a crucial role in maintaining the structure and function of the cell membrane.
